Evolution Process of Compressor for PG9351(FA+e) Type Gas Turbines

Meng Guang-tai

Open publisher page 0 citations

Abstract

The paper introduces the development process of GE heavy gas turbine,existing problems of its F type compressor and the facility situation of domestic PG9351(FA+e) type gas turbines.Detailed analysis has been carried out on the existing problems.The improvement on each stage of compressor blades for the gas turbine is presented.
